Blessed Alacrinus of Casamari
Blessed Alacrinus of Casamari (died c. 1216 AD in Casamari, Lazio, Italy) was a Cistercian monk of the Abbey of Casamari in Lazio, Italy. He is venerated as one of the early holy monks of Casamari, which became a major Cistercian house in central Italy in the 12th and 13th centuries. His feast day is February 19.

Biography
Alacrinus of Casamari was a Cistercian monk of the Abbey of Casamari in Lazio, one of the most important Cistercian monasteries in central Italy. The abbey had been a Benedictine foundation (1035) before being reformed as Cistercian in 1140; Alacrinus was part of the early generations of this reformed community.
He lived the austere Cistercian life of manual labor, liturgical prayer, and contemplative silence in the Ciociaria hills of Lazio. He died c. 1216 and is venerated locally on February 19. The Abbey of Casamari — still an active Cistercian community — preserves his memory within the tradition of its early holy monks.
